SOAP notes are turned in with your treatment plans every week. Check with your supervisor for deadlines. S: Describe your impressions of the client in the subjective section. Include your impressions about the client s/patient s level of awareness, motivation, mood, willingness to participate. You may also list here anything the.

  2. In the subjective section, describe your impressions of the client. Include your observations about their level of awareness, motivation, mood, and willingness to participate. Incorporate any statements made by the client or their family during the session.
  3. In the objective section, record measurable and quantitative data about the client's performance. This may include test scores, percentages of goal achievement, and any relevant metrics that indicate the client's progress.
  4. In the assessment section, analyze the data you gathered. Compare the client's performance across different sessions and interpret any changes observed. This supports the justification for continued treatment.
  5. In the plan section, outline the proposed course of treatment moving forward. Detail any changes in objectives, activities, or schedules that may be needed based on your assessment.

A SLP soap note is a structured document that Speech-Language Pathologists use to record patient progress. In a clinical impressions example speech therapy, the 'S' represents the subjective observations, such as a patient's self-reported difficulties. The 'O' stands for objective data, like results from communication assessments. The 'A' includes an assessment or analysis, and the 'P' outlines the plan for further therapy sessions.

To calculate Mean Length of Utterance (MLU), count the total number of morphemes in a language sample, then divide that number by the total number of utterances. This calculation provides insight into a speaker's language complexity. The big 9 areas in speech language pathology include articulation, fluency, voice, receptive language, expressive language, social communication, cognitive-communication, swallowing, and augmentative/alternative communication.
